JOB STATEMENT :
Reporting to the Director, Business Systems and Development and working in a fast-paced environment, the Business Systems Analyst is responsible for working with all departments and business lines by providing Level II support, documenting requirements, release management, change controls, testing system implementations / updates as well as documenting business processes. This highly motivated and energetic candidate must work with the Business as well as the I.T. department to ensure all requests are documented and prioritized.
RESPONSIBILITIES :
- Identifying, evaluating and prioritizing customer requests to ensure that inquiries are successfully resolved;
- Setting priorities for Level II problem resolutions, monitoring progress and applying the appropriate escalation procedures;
- Liaising with the business areas and I.T. to evaluate and / or develop solutions based on the requirements;
- Managing requirements gathering for scheduled upgrades, migrations and approved projects;
- Analyzing and evaluating the impact of application enhancements and / or updates;
- Researching, evaluating and recommending new products and upgrades;
- Investigating and documenting system bugs (Defect Management);
- Working closely with various departments within the organization to understand and document all business / systems requirements for existing systems, processes, system implementations;
- Producing technical and descriptive documentation;
- Interpreting technical and procedure manuals for non-technical users;
- Assisting in training users in the use of applications and computer systems;
- Organizing individual time, work and resources to accomplish objectives in the most effective and efficient way;
- Demonstrating a rational and organized approach to work and identify development opportunities;
- Interacting with the testing team and / or vendors to provide technical input, support and analysis on applications; and
- Participating in other corporate projects and initiatives as necessary.
